This book is an outcome of the discussions held at the Ernst Strüngmann Forum on ―Rethinking Environmentalism: Justice, Sustainability, and Diversity‖ on June 19–24, 2016, in Frankfurt am Main, Germany. The participants of the forum, who are stalwarts in their respective fields, authored the chapters in this book. It provides a comprehensive review of the justice, sustainability, and diversity frameworks used to study environmental problems, and I am tempted to call it a reader.
